To Whom it may concern. This past December I purchased a simulated wood dash kit on Ebay from a company called Amdtrims, www.amdtrims.com, 2102 Utica Avenue, Brooklyn NY 11234, (718)258-2300.

Prior to this date I saw the ad for their products but they had no listing on Ebay for a 2004 Nissan Murano. So back in November I had purchased this same kit over the phone. Then back in November.

I started having problems with the kit so I called and contacted Alex whom I believe is the manager or owner. He assures me that these issues will be corrected by replacing the wrong fitting parts as well as the parts I goofed up. I also on three occasions offered to pay for the materials and shipping and he refused. This is all fine Alex stated Ill take care of it .

Well It's the beginning of March now and more than 40 e-mails and 13 phone calls later I'm still in the same boat I was back in November only this time, I now own 2 incomplete kits that are installed. I have saved all the e-mail copies and kept records of our phone conversations. Alex has stated, I swear I sent them out to you! His excuses are from: My mother moved here from Russia and I had to find her an apartment to, : It's not my fault this time honest and another, Well I had to make sure the parts fit before I send them.

As stated above I can forward any or all of my documentation to get this fraud from ruining the on line trading process.
